
Meet the Heart of the Walking Woman Celebration Finalists
The Heart of the Walking Woman Celebration — which is a tradition at College of Saint Mary — recognizes students who exemplify character, service and leadership on campus. Inductees took some time to reflect on what it means to them to be chosen as a finalist for this prestigious honor. Winners will be chosen during a ceremony on Friday, Feb. 23.
